Children's Choice Book Award 2016
The Children’s Choice Book Awards are the only national book awards program where the winning titles are selected by children and teens; they were launched in 2008 by the Children’s Book Council and Every Child a Reader. The 2016 Children’s Choice Book Awards winners have been announced. The announcement is a highlight of Children's Book Week, which is running this year from May 2–8.
Kindergarten-2nd Grade Book of the Year: THE LITTLE SHOP OF MONSTERS by R.L. Stine, illus. by Marc Brown
3rd-4th Grade Book of the Year: I’M TRYING TO LOVE SPIDERS by Bethany Barton
5th-6th Grade Book of the Year: HILO BOOK 1: The Boy Who Crashed to Earth by Judd Winick
Children's Choice Debut Author: Alex Gino for GEORGE
Children's Choice Illustrator: Kate Beaton for THE PRINCESS AND THE PONY
